[38.01] Observations of the Lunar Sodium Atmosphere during the 1999 Quadrantids Meteor Shower

S. Verani (ISSI, Bern), C. Barbieri (Universit\`a di Padova), C. Benn (ING, La Palma), G. Cremonese (Osservatorio Astronomico di Padova), M. Mendillo (Center for Space Physics, Boston U.)

We present results relating to observations of the lunar sodium atmosphere during the 1999 Quadrantids meteor shower, on January 2 - 3, i.e. on the night of the predicted maximum and on the following night. The Moon was just past full.

At first glance the intensity of the sodium emission lines doesn't show any enhancement relative to published values for similar lunar phase. This contrast with some previous observations of the Moon during other meteor shower as the Leonids. Possible explainations, for istance in terms of impact energy difference, are presented here.
